Drive by shooting injures man in Antioch, Sunday night

By Ofc. B. Hewitt, Antioch Police Field Services Bureau

On Sunday, August 31, 2013 at approximately 6:55 p.m., a group of citizens were gathered behind the apartments in the 1600 block of Sycamore Drive for a block party. A vehicle was seen speeding west bound through the alley and an occupant of the vehicle fired several shots, striking a 25-year-old male. The victim was transported to a local hospital where he was treated for his injury and released. The investigation is still ongoing.
